About Sydney

Sydney: A Vibrant Touristic Destination

Located on the east coast of Australia, Sydney is a vibrant and diverse city that offers a plethora of attractions for tourists. From iconic landmarks to beautiful beaches, world-class dining to exciting nightlife, there is something for everyone in this bustling metropolis.

Iconic Landmarks

No visit to Sydney is complete without a stop at the world-famous Sydney Opera House and the Sydney Harbour Bridge. These architectural marvels are not only visually stunning but also offer unique experiences such as guided tours, concerts, and bridge climbs that provide breathtaking views of the city.

Cultural Experiences

For those interested in history and culture, Sydney boasts a number of museums and galleries worth exploring. The Art Gallery of New South Wales showcases a diverse collection of Australian and international art, while the Australian Museum offers insights into the country's natural and cultural heritage.

Natural Beauty

Surrounded by stunning natural landscapes, Sydney is a paradise for outdoor enthusiasts. Bondi Beach, one of the city's most famous beaches, is perfect for sunbathing, surfing, and people-watching. For a more tranquil experience, head to the Royal Botanic Garden or take a ferry to Taronga Zoo for a close encounter with native wildlife.

Culinary Delights

Sydney's dining scene is a melting pot of flavors from around the world. Whether you're craving fresh seafood at Sydney Fish Market, gourmet cuisine at a waterfront restaurant in Darling Harbour, or multicultural street food at Chinatown, you're sure to find something to satisfy your taste buds.

Shopping and Entertainment

From upscale boutiques in The Rocks to trendy fashion stores in Newtown, Sydney is a shopper's paradise. After a day of retail therapy, catch a performance at the Sydney Theatre Company or enjoy a night out in the vibrant neighborhoods of Kings Cross or Surry Hills.

Day Trips and Excursions

For those looking to explore beyond the city limits, Sydney offers a variety of day trips and excursions. Visit the scenic Blue Mountains for hiking and breathtaking views, take a wine tour in the Hunter Valley region, or embark on a cruise to Manly Beach for a taste of coastal living.

Conclusion

With its mix of natural beauty, cultural attractions, and lively atmosphere, Sydney is a top-notch touristic destination that never fails to impress visitors. Whether you're seeking adventure, relaxation, or simply a taste of Australian hospitality, this dynamic city has it all.

Sydney Transport Information

Getting to Sydney by Air

Travelers heading to Sydney, Australia, will most likely arrive at the bustling Sydney Kingsford Smith Airport. As the country's busiest airport, it serves as a major hub for international and domestic flights. Located just 8 kilometers from the city center, visitors can easily reach their destination by taking a taxi, shuttle bus, or train from the airport. The Airport Link train service offers a convenient and efficient way to travel to various parts of the city, with trains departing frequently throughout the day.

Getting to Sydney by Road

For those opting to travel to Sydney by road, several highways provide access to the city from different parts of Australia. The Hume Highway connects Sydney to Melbourne, while the Pacific Highway links the city to Brisbane. Travelers can also drive along the Princes Highway from Adelaide or Canberra. Once in Sydney, visitors can navigate the city's streets using a network of well-maintained roads and highways, making it easy to explore the various neighborhoods and attractions at their own pace.

Transportation Inside the City

Once in Sydney, visitors have a range of transportation options to choose from to get around the city. The extensive public transport system includes buses, trains, ferries, and light rail services, providing convenient and affordable ways to travel within Sydney. The Opal card, a smartcard payment system, can be used across all modes of public transport, offering seamless transfers between different services. Additionally, taxis and ride-sharing services are readily available for those looking for a more personalized mode of transportation within the city.
